INDIA, Post-Mauryan (Punjab). Taxila (local coinage). 1/4 Unit (Bronze, 12x13 mm, 1.55 g, 8 h), Taxila city state (Pushkalavati), circa 185-170 BC. Indradhvaja and 3-arched hill; below, nadipada. Rev. Lotus standard and 3-arched hill; below, swastika. Cf. HGC 12, 819 (for 1/2 unit). Apparently unpublished in this denomination. Cleaning scratches, otherwise, about very fine.
